STAFF REPORT
Case No:96-203
Applicant: Steve Arden, Brazosland Realty for Begonia Corporation
ITEM:
Consideration of a Final Plat for.Edelweiss Estates Phase.4-A
ITEM SUNIlVIARY AND STAFF RECOMMENDATION..
This plat is located along the southwest,right-of-way line of Victoria Avenue, northeast
of North Grahame Road. A Preliminary. plat.. of Phase 4 was approved by Council orn
January 12, 1995. Theplatconsists of 10.605 acres and 41 single family residential
lots. A presubmission conference was held on February 2,.:.1996 at which time staff
had as few minor comments. Staff recommends approval of the plat with the
Presubmission Conference comments.

ENGINEERING COM1V>ENTS
Water -Available in Victoria Avenue and Mortier Drive and will be extended
into this subdivision.
Sewer -Available in Victoria Avenue and will be extended into this
subdivision. There will be sewer impact fees associated with this
subdivision.
Streets -Adequate to handle traffic that will be generated from this
subdivision
Drainage -Drainage will be underground and will be carried to Mortier Drive
where it will enter the underground system in Mortier
and be transferred to the detention facility at the corner of
Mortier and Victoria.
Flood Plain -None
Sidewalks -Sidewalks will be constructed on both. sides of Arnold and one
side of Vienna Drive.
Parkland Dedication -Previously dedicated.
SUBDIVISION ORDINANCE. COMPLIANCE
.The plat' as submitted. complies. with the' subdivision regulations and there are no
variances being-requested.
